    Map It with Commas! Using Commas in Place Names for Class 2 

    This Class 2 worksheet helps children learn how to use commas correctly when writing place names such as “Mumbai, Maharashtra” or “Delhi, India.” Children understand that when a city and state (or country) appear together, a comma separates them. 
    Through MCQs, True/False checks, comma-insertion sentences, rewriting tasks, and a paragraph-editing exercise, learners get repeated practice applying this rule in real contexts. 

    Why Commas in Place Names Matter?

     1. Helps children write addresses and place names clearly. 
    2. Builds awareness of real-world writing conventions. 
    3. Strengthens punctuation skills used in projects and assignments. 
    4. Improves clarity in informational writing.
